Determine the number of electrons flowing
per second through a conductor, where
current of 32 A flows through it.​

Answer:

n= 20*10^{19}

Explanation:

The number of electrons flowing per second = n

I = 32A

t = 1 sec

Charge of electron, e = 1.6*10^{-19}  C

I = \frac{q}{t}

q=ne

I= \frac{ne}{t}

n= \frac{It}{e}=\frac{32A * 1 s}{1.6*10^{-19} C}

n= 20*10^{19}
